RTC External Components
The RTC requires connecting an external 32.768 kHz crystal and C
1
, C
2
load capacitance as shown in the Figure 5. The figure shows
the recommnded RTC external component values. The load capacitances C
1
and C
2
are inclusive of parasitic of the printed circuit
board (PCB). The PCB parasitic includes the capacitance due to land pattern of crystal pads/pins, X
in
/X
out
pads and copper traces
connecting crystal and device pins.
